The Ultimate Boozy Royal Rhino Panna Cotta

I love grownup, boozy desserts, so when brainstorming a dessert to make using The Royal Rhino African Liqueur, my first thought was a boozy Royal Rhino Panna Cotta. Is your mouth watering yet?

Royal Rhino Panna Cotta

The Royal Rhino African Cream Liqueur is pure decadence – with the rich aroma of black roasted African Arabica coffee beans, balanced with the lingering taste of creamy vanilla.

You can enjoy it served over ice or create a decadent dessert to wow your dinner guests, like my Boozy Panna Cotta.

Panna Cotta Ingredients

  • 200ml Milk
  • 300ml Cream
  • 200ml Royal Rhino African Cream
  • 20ml Gelatin Powder
  • 50ml Cold Water
  • 1 tsp Organic Honey (optional)
Royal Rhino Cream Liqueur

Coffee Gel Ingredients

  • 150ml Espresso Coffee
  • 50ml Sugar
  • 5ml Gelatin Powder
  • 15ml Cold Water
Royal Rhino Panna Cotta

Method

For the panna cotta, place 50ml cold water in a small bowl and sprinkle in the powdered gelatin, then whisk with a fork. Set aside until the gelatin is thick. Next, place the bowl containing the gelatin mixture over hot water and stir until the gelatin has dissolved. Alternatively, place your gelatin mixture in the microwave for 20 to 30 seconds until dissolved.

Combine the milk, cream, Royal Rhino Liqueur and honey (optional if you prefer a slightly sweeter dessert) in a saucepan and stir over low heat. Do not allow the liquid to boil. Remove from the heat, add the gelatin mixture and mix well. Then pour into individual serving glasses and refrigerate for approximately three to four hours.

For the coffee gel, dissolve the gelatin as you did for the panna cotta mixture. Heat the coffee and sugar in a saucepan until the sugar has dissolved. Remove from the heat and allow to cool for a few minutes. Once cooled, add the gelatine mixture and mix well. After the panna cotta has been in the fridge for an hour, top each panna cotta with a layer of coffee gel. Place back in the fridge until completely set.

Serve the panna cotta topped with shards of salted honeycomb. Enjoy!
